Movie Delivery: Optimizing for Mobile and Connection Capacity
To ensure a fluid viewing experience on portable devices, film streaming platforms must focus on optimizing content for constrained bandwidth situations. This requires techniques like adaptive bit-rate delivery, which adjusts the movie quality based on the user’s available internet access. Furthermore, efficient video compression and lightweight downloads are vital for lowering buffering and delivering a superior streaming execution.

How Video Flowing Technology Operates: From Clip to Display
The path of getting a video from its initial segment to your display involves a complex system of actions. Initially, the video is encoded into a digital format, often using codecs like H.264 or H.265, which drastically reduces the file size. This compressed video is then broken into smaller packets and sent to a content distribution network (CDN). The CDN network strategically places servers throughout the globe to ensure low latency and efficient delivery to viewers regardless of their location. Your machine then downloads these segments and reconstructs them, uncompressing the video back into a viewable format on your screen.
